Authorized Generics: What They Are and Why They Matter

When you hear authorized generics, brand-name drugs sold under a generic label, made by the original manufacturer with identical ingredients and packaging. Also known as brand-generic, they’re not knockoffs—they’re the real thing, just cheaper. Unlike regular generics, which are made by different companies after the patent expires, authorized generics come straight from the same factory, same formula, same quality control. You get the exact same pill, capsule, or injection—same color, same size, same inactive ingredients—as the brand-name version, but without the marketing cost.

This matters because generic drugs, lower-cost versions of brand-name medications approved by the FDA often get a bad rap. People worry about quality, effectiveness, or even how they look. But with authorized generics, those fears vanish. You’re not guessing. You’re getting the same drug your doctor prescribed, just with a different label. And since they’re produced by the original maker, they don’t face the same manufacturing defects—like capping, contamination, or weight variation—that sometimes show up in third-party generics. This isn’t theory. It’s fact. The FDA requires them to meet the same standards as the brand-name version, down to the last milligram.

Why do companies make them? To stay competitive. When a brand-name drug’s patent runs out, the original maker can launch an authorized generic to capture market share before other generic companies even start production. It’s a smart business move—and a win for you. Prices drop faster. Insurance companies prefer them. Pharmacies stock them. And because they’re identical to the brand, your body won’t react differently. No new side effects. No adjustment period. Just the same relief, at a fraction of the cost.

It’s not just about saving money. It’s about trust. If you’ve had bad experiences with regular generics—maybe a different pill made you feel off, or your insurance switched you without warning—authorized generics remove that uncertainty. You know exactly what you’re getting. No surprises. No guesswork. And with drug shortages still a problem in 2025, having more reliable supply options like authorized generics helps keep medications flowing when they’re needed most.
